MSI-78 Magainin Pharmaceuticals
1Hoechst Marion Roussel, 102 Route de Noisy, 93235 Romainville Cedex, France. Khalid.Islam@hmrag.com
Summary
MSI-78, a novel peptide anti-infective, demonstrated efficacy comparable to ofloxacin for diabetic foot ulcers. Further trials will explore its wound healing potential in various infections.
Area of Science:
- Pharmacology
- Dermatology
- Infectious Diseases
Background:
- Magainin is developing MSI-78, a 22-amino acid peptide derived from frog skin compounds, as a topical anti-infective agent.
- MSI-78 exhibits broad-spectrum activity against Gram-positive bacteria, Gram-negative bacteria, anaerobic bacteria, and Candida albicans.
Purpose of the Study:
- To evaluate the efficacy and safety of MSI-78 for the treatment of infections in diabetic foot ulcers.
- To compare MSI-78 with orally-administered ofloxacin in a pivotal Phase III trial.
Main Methods:
- A pivotal Phase III trial involving 584 patients with diabetic foot ulcers was conducted.
- Statistical equivalence was assessed between MSI-78 and ofloxacin based on clinical response at day 10 and day 28, and follow-up.
- A second Phase III trial confirmed these findings, with additional data on organism eradication and wound healing presented.
Main Results:
- MSI-78 demonstrated statistical equivalence to ofloxacin in treating diabetic foot ulcer infections.
- Both treatments were comparable in terms of organism eradication and wound healing rates.
- MSI-78 showed a favorable side-effect profile, with less insomnia compared to ofloxacin.
Conclusions:
- MSI-78 is a promising topical anti-infective agent for diabetic foot ulcers, with efficacy comparable to oral ofloxacin.
- Further research is warranted to explore MSI-78's wound-healing capabilities in various types of wounds.
- MSI-78 has potential for treating other infections, including those associated with surgical wounds, decubitus ulcers, and burns.
